    Abstract: Disclosed herein are methods and systems for automatically validating evidence of traffic violations. One instance of a method comprises receiving an evidence package comprising video frames showing a vehicle involved in a potential traffic violation. The video frames can be input into one or more deep learning models to obtain a plurality of classification results. The method can further comprise generating a score based in part on the classification results and evaluating the score against one or more thresholds to determine whether the evidence package is automatically approved, is automatically rejected, or requires further review.

    Abstract: Disclosed herein are methods, devices, and systems for automatically detecting double parking violations. For example, one aspect of the disclosure concerns a method comprising determining a location of a road edge of a roadway from one or more video frames of a video captured by one or more video image sensors of an edge device; determining a layout of one or more lanes of the roadway, including a no-parking lane, based on the road edge; bounding the no-parking lane using a lane bounding polygon; bounding a vehicle detected from the one or more video frames using a vehicle bounding polygon; and detecting a potential double parking violation based in part on an overlap of at least part of the vehicle bounding polygon with at least part of the lane bounding polygon and a determination of whether the vehicle is static or moving.
